What is a local CDL driver?

Local CDL Drivers are professional truck drivers who hold a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) and operate commercial vehicles within a specific geographic area, usually within a city or region. Unlike long-haul truckers, local CDL drivers typically return home at the end of each workday and are responsible for transporting goods between local warehouses, distribution centers, and businesses. Their duties often include loading and unloading cargo, performing vehicle inspections, and adhering to safety regulations. This role is ideal for those who want to drive professionally without spending extended periods away from home.

How hard is it to get a local CDL driver job?

Securing a local CDL driver job typically requires a valid commercial driver's license, a clean driving record, and sometimes a few years of driving experience. Employers may also conduct background checks and drug tests, and having knowledge of safety regulations and route planning can improve chances of employment.

What are common challenges faced by local CDL drivers, and how can they be managed?

Local CDL Drivers often face challenges such as navigating heavy traffic, meeting tight delivery schedules, and handling frequent loading or unloading of cargo. Effective time management and strong communication with dispatchers can help mitigate scheduling issues. Additionally, maintaining a good understanding of local routes and regulations, as well as practicing safe driving habits, are essential for overcoming daily obstacles and ensuring smooth operations.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a local CDL driver?

To thrive as a Local CDL Driver, you need a valid Commercial Driver’s License (CDL), safe driving skills, and knowledge of local traffic laws and routes. Familiarity with electronic logging devices (ELDs), GPS navigation systems, and basic vehicle maintenance tools is typically required. Strong time management, reliability, and effective communication with dispatchers and customers are standout soft skills. These abilities ensure timely and safe deliveries, regulatory compliance, and positive working relationships, which are critical for success in this role.

What is the difference between Local Cdl Driver vs Long-Haul Truck Driver?

AspectLocal Cdl DriverLong-Haul Truck Driver
Work EnvironmentWithin a specific region or city, often working daily shiftsAcross states or countries, with extended periods away from home
CertificationsCommercial Driver's License (CDL)Commercial Driver's License (CDL)
Job FocusDelivering goods locally, often to retail stores or warehousesTransporting goods over long distances, often cross-country
Work ScheduleMore predictable, daily routesIrregular, extended trips with time away from home

While both roles require a CDL and involve driving commercial trucks, Local Cdl Drivers focus on short-distance deliveries within a region, offering more predictable schedules. Long-Haul Truck Drivers operate over longer distances, often across states or countries, with extended time away from home. Your choice depends on your preference for local work versus long-distance travel.
